no i need the thing called EXACTLY Add/Remove Hardware those arent wat i need im trying to add loopback adapter
1. Click Start – Search for cmd, right-click cmd and select “Run as Administrator”
2. From the command prompt, run “hdwwiz.exe“. This should launch the “Add Hardware Wizard“. Click Next.
hddwiz1-300x232.png

3. Select “Install the hardware that I manually select from a list (Advanced)” and click Next.
hddwiz2-300x232.png

4. Now from the list select and click Next.
hddwiz3-300x232.png

5. Under Manufacturers, select Microsoft and select “Microsoft Loopback Adapter” under Network Adapter and click Next. This should start the installation. Click Finish when the installation completes.
hddwiz4-300x232.png
hddwiz5-300x232.png

hddwiz6-300x232.png

To confirm the loopback adapter installed, right-click, select properties. Click Device Manager and expand Network Adapters and you can see the Loopback adapter installed there.
